Mini Pineapple and Condensed Coconut Milk Cheesecakes

Discover the perfect blend of tropical flavors in these Mini Pineapple and Condensed Coconut Milk Cheesecakes. Ideal for summer desserts or any occasion where you want to impress with a small yet indulgent treat, these cheesecakes offer a creamy coconut milk base with the refreshing essence of pineapple, all nestled on a cinnamon-spiced biscuit crust.

Ingredients:

Prepare these essentials to create your mini cheesecake delights:

  • 180 g plain sweet biscuits (such as Nice, Granita or Milk Arrowroot)
  • ½ tsp ground cinnamon
  • 90 g unsalted butter, melted
  • 85 g packet pineapple-flavored jelly
  • 125 ml (1/2 cup) boiling water
  • 160 ml (2/3 cup) cold water
  • 250 g packet cream cheese, at room temperature
  • 125 ml (1/2 cup) sweetened condensed coconut milk
  • 150 g (1/2 cup) well-drained crushed pineapple
  • 250 ml (1 cup) thickened cream

Directions:

Follow these step-by-step instructions to create your own mini cheesecakes:

  1. Prepare the Base:
    • Lightly spray twelve 80ml silicone muffin pans with oil spray. Line each with a strip of baking paper, extending over the sides.
    • Process biscuits and cinnamon in a food processor until fine crumbs form. Add melted butter and process until combined. Press mixture firmly into each pan to form the base. Chill in the fridge.
  2. Make the Pineapple Jelly:
    • Dissolve pineapple jelly crystals in boiling water in a heatproof bowl. Stir in cold water and set aside to cool until just starting to set.
  3. Prepare the Cheesecake Filling:
    • Beat cream cheese and sweetened condensed coconut milk until smooth using an electric beater.
    • Add cooled pineapple jelly mixture and stir until smooth. Fold in crushed pineapple.
  4. Fold in Cream:
    • In a separate bowl, beat 125ml of thickened cream until soft peaks form. Gently fold into the pineapple mixture until combined.
  5. Assemble and Chill:
    • Spoon the cheesecake mixture evenly over the biscuit base in each pan. Tap gently to remove air bubbles. Smooth the surface and refrigerate for 6 hours or overnight until firm.
  6. Serve and Garnish:
    • Once set, loosen the cheesecakes using a knife and lift out using the baking paper strips.
    • Beat remaining 125ml of thickened cream until firm peaks form. Pipe swirls of whipped cream on top of each cheesecake before serving.

Additional Information:

  • Prep Time: 6 hours 40 minutes (includes chilling time)
  • Cooking Time: None
  • Total Time: 6 hours 40 minutes
  • Servings: 12 mini cheesecakes
  • Calories: Approximately 250 kcal per serving

 

Serving and Storage Tips :

To ensure your mini cheesecakes are enjoyed at their best, here are some essential serving and storage tips:

Serving Tips:

  1. Chill Before Serving: For the best texture, make sure the cheesecakes are thoroughly chilled for at least 6 hours or overnight before serving.
  2. Presentation Matters: Before serving, garnish each cheesecake with a swirl of whipped cream, a small wedge of fresh pineapple, and a maraschino cherry for an appealing look.
  3. Serve Chilled: These cheesecakes are best enjoyed cold. Remove them from the refrigerator just before serving to maintain their firm texture.
  4. Ideal Pairings: Serve with a side of fresh fruit, a drizzle of coconut syrup, or a light dusting of toasted coconut flakes for added flavor and texture.
  5. Elegant Touch: For a special occasion, consider adding a sprinkle of crushed pistachios or a few edible flowers on top for an elegant touch.

Storage Tips:

  1. Refrigeration: Store any leftover cheesecakes in an airtight container in the refrigerator. They will stay fresh for up to 3-4 days.
  2. Freeze for Later: These cheesecakes can be frozen for up to 1 month. Wrap each cheesecake individually in plastic wrap, then place them in a freezer-safe container or zip-lock bag. Thaw in the refrigerator for a few hours before serving.
  3. Avoid Excess Moisture: To prevent sogginess, ensure the cheesecakes are well-covered and stored in a dry place in the refrigerator.
  4. No Freezer Burn: If freezing, ensure the cheesecakes are well-wrapped to avoid freezer burn and maintain their creamy texture.
  5. Avoid Toppings Until Serving: If you plan to store them, it’s best to add the whipped cream topping just before serving to keep it fresh and fluffy.

Variations :

Enhance and personalize your Mini Pineapple and Condensed Coconut Milk Cheesecakes with these creative variations:

  1. Mango Madness:
    • Substitute crushed pineapple with well-drained, pureed mango for a tropical twist. Garnish with fresh mango slices on top.
  2. Citrus Burst:
    • Add 1-2 tablespoons of freshly grated orange or lemon zest to the cheesecake mixture for a citrusy flavor. Top with candied citrus peel for an extra zing.
  3. Coconut Chocolate Crunch:
    • Mix shredded coconut into the biscuit base and sprinkle chocolate shavings over the whipped cream topping before serving. Use a chocolate-flavored crust for added richness.
  4. Pina Colada Inspired:
    • Use coconut-flavored biscuits for the crust and blend in a tablespoon of coconut cream into the cheesecake filling. Top with toasted coconut flakes and a maraschino cherry.
  5. Nutty Delight:
    • Add a handful of chopped toasted macadamia nuts or almonds to the biscuit base for a crunchy texture. Garnish with more nuts on top.
  6. Berry Bliss:
    • Fold in a handful of fresh or frozen berries (such as strawberries, blueberries, or raspberries) into the cheesecake filling. Top with a dollop of berry compote or coulis.
  7. Tropical Rum Infusion:
    • Replace some of the cold water in the jelly with coconut rum or spiced rum for a boozy twist. Top with a drizzle of rum caramel sauce before serving.
  8. Tropical Tiramisu:
    • Dip the biscuit base in brewed espresso or coffee before assembling the cheesecakes. Add a dusting of cocoa powder on top of the whipped cream.
  9. Lemon Lime Zest:
    • Substitute pineapple jelly with lemon or lime-flavored jelly. Add a hint of lime zest to the cream cheese mixture for a refreshing citrus flavor.
  10. Chocolate Dipped:
    • Drizzle melted chocolate over the top of the whipped cream before serving, adding a decadent touch to the tropical flavors.

FAQs :

Here are answers to common questions about making and enjoying these delightful mini cheesecakes:

  1. Can I use a different type of biscuit for the crust? Yes, you can use graham crackers, digestive biscuits, or any other plain sweet biscuits as a substitute for the crust.
  2. What can I use instead of pineapple-flavored jelly? If you prefer not to use pineapple-flavored jelly, you can substitute with any other fruit-flavored jelly or gelatin that complements the tropical flavors, such as mango or passion fruit.
  3. Can I use fresh pineapple instead of canned crushed pineapple? Yes, you can use fresh pineapple that has been finely chopped or pureed. Ensure it’s well-drained to avoid excess moisture in the cheesecake filling.
  4. How long do these cheesecakes need to set in the refrigerator? It’s recommended to refrigerate the cheesecakes for at least 6 hours or overnight until they are firm and set. This allows the flavors to meld together for the best taste.
  5. Can I make these cheesecakes ahead of time? Yes, these mini cheesecakes can be made ahead of time. Store them in the refrigerator in an airtight container for up to 3-4 days. Add the whipped cream topping just before serving.
  6. How do I prevent the cheesecakes from sticking to the silicone muffin pans? Lightly spray the silicone muffin pans with oil spray and line each with a strip of baking paper extending over the sides. This makes it easier to lift the cheesecakes out once they are set.
  7. Can I freeze these cheesecakes? Yes, you can freeze these mini cheesecakes for up to 1 month. Wrap each cheesecake individually in plastic wrap and store in a freezer-safe container. Thaw in the refrigerator before serving.
  8. How can I adjust the sweetness of the cheesecakes? Taste the cheesecake mixture before spooning it into the pans. Adjust the sweetness by adding more or less sweetened condensed coconut milk or by using a sweeter or less sweet jelly.
  9. What can I use instead of sweetened condensed coconut milk? If you can’t find sweetened condensed coconut milk, you can use regular sweetened condensed milk or make your own by simmering coconut milk with sugar until thickened.
  10. Can I decorate these cheesecakes with anything other than whipped cream? Absolutely! You can decorate them with fresh fruit slices, toasted coconut flakes, or a drizzle of fruit syrup or caramel sauce for added flavor and visual appeal.
